This is an amazing opportunity to obtain a leadership position with a super fun, fast-paced, high growth youth sports company that is having a positive impact on our community. The Program Manager is a full-time position with a competitive starting salary ($48,000-$53,000), bonus opportunities, company sponsored 401k matching plan and paid vacation and paid federal holidays.
About the Program Manager Position
The Program Manager is responsible for the coordination and implementation of activities associated with running our youth sports leagues, clinics and camps in the Loudoun County and Central/Northern Fairfax County territories. The position will work out of our office in Fairfax City with some travel throughout our Fairfax County and Loudoun County focus areas to visit venues, market the programs and meet with partners.
Reports to: Athletic Director, i9 Sports Loudoun County/Fairfax County
Job Functions
Operations:
  • Creates and facilitates the i9 Sports experience on the field/court ensuring that all venues maintain a 65 or greater NPS score
  • Develops and executes NPS action plans
  • Follow all procedures and processes for efficiency and develop recommendations to improve them
  • Lead recruitment of parent coaches, background checks and assign to teams
  • Ensure all programs have parent coaches, including substitutes as needed
  • Works with Operations Manager to ensure that emails and voicemails are answered within 48 hours
  • Lead hiring process for new staff for programs
  • Lead recruitment of current and former staff for future programs
  • Oversee scheduling and monitor staffing for all programs
  • Works with Athletic Director to ensure accurate payroll each week
  • Ensure all programs are fully staffed
  • Develop and implement ongoing in-person and virtual training for staff and parent coaches
  • Ensures game day processes and procedures are followed and completed in a timely manner
  • Follow-up on parent and volunteer issues
  • Ensure that all locations are operating at or above the established standards
  • Additional administrative duties as needed
Requirements and Qualifications:
  • Excellent attention to detail, pattern identification and motivated to create processes that optimize and improve the way things are done
  • Excellent analytical skills
  • Strong interpersonal skills and ability to communicate with all stakeholders
  • Self-motivated, works efficiently and meets reasonable deadlines
  • Able to multitask, prioritize, and manage time effectively
  • Enjoys a challenging, high energy and dynamic environment
  • Able to make professional decisions in a fast-paced environment and own results
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Capable in both a leadership and team-player role to get the job done
  • Has experience playing sports and understands its potential to have a positive impact on the community if implemented correctly
  • Event management experience preferred
  • Bachelors degree
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Gmail, Google Drive, etc
General schedule (in-season): Approx. 45 Weeks of the year
Thursday, Friday, & Monday; 9-5pm; Saturdays 7-4pm & Sundays 8-4pm (subject to flexibility/changes according to Game Day needs)
General schedule (off-season):Approx. 7 Weeks of the year
Monday Friday; 9am-5pm (subject to flexibility/changes as other opportunities arise)
Job Type: Full-time
Salary: $48,000.00 - $53,000.00 per year
Benefits
Full-time employees are eligible for the following company benefits:
  • Opportunity to earn annual bonus contingent on individual and organizational performance and attainment of goals
  • 401k i9 Sports will match employee contributions up to 4% of annual salary
  • 13 days / 104 hours paid vacation per year, which is accrued at the rate of 2.3 hours per pay period.
  • 8 paid federal holidays per year
  • 3 paid sick days per year
  • Flex time during weekdays if working on weekends during season.
  • 2 weeks paid paternity/maternity leave
